One more question, is it possible to have more than one Region, for example if a company is have the position on multiple cities.. ?

Hi again,

Unfortunately, Job postings can’t have multiple regions assigned to them. A new Job posting will need to be created for the other region the job is located. The WP Job Manager plugin does not allow for Posts to have multiple regions or locations, unfortunately.

Can i change all the filter settings (e.g.. create filters) in the search for a job page/option.

And also, can i then create jobs that link to the new filters/labels?

Hi there!

Hope you are doing well and thank you for your questions!

Question: Can i change all the filter settings (e.g.. create filters) in the search for a job page/option. And also, can i then create jobs that link to the new filters/labels?

Answer: Creating filters and associating them with Listings is currently not something that can be done out of the box. It can be achieved with customization. This article can give you the right idea as it creates a new field for Job posts and can create a filter from it: https://wpjobmanager.com/document/tutorial-adding-a-salary-field-for-jobs/

An alternative way to create fields is using the WP Job Manager Field Editor plugin.

Question: Also can i change the language of it to Dutch?

Answer: The Dutch translation of Jobify still needs some work as it is 39% complete. You can help contribute and translate the website. See here: Translating Your Entire Website

import from linkedin not working?

Hi again,

There is no feature available for Importing from Linkedin that was supported by our theme. There used to be an “Apply with LinkedIn” feature provided by WP Job Manager, but it no longer is available since they stopped providing the feature.
